Capsules and Soft Gels Drive Product Innovation

By product format, Capsules accounted for the largest share at 38.60% in 2025, owing to their high bioavailability, precise dosing, and compatibility with multi-ingredient fertility formulations. Capsules are widely used across both female and male fertility products and remain the preferred format in premium nutraceutical lines.

Soft gels are projected to grow at a CAGR of 6.89% during the forecast period. Their popularity is supported by rising demand for fat-soluble nutrients such as vitamins D and E, which play a critical role in reproductive health and hormonal function.

Tablets remain a stable and cost-effective format, particularly in prenatal and preconception supplements, benefiting from scalability and extended shelf life. Meanwhile, powders and liquids occupy niche segments, largely serving personalized nutrition programs and clinical fertility applications.

Regional Insights: North America Leads, Asia Pacific Emerges as Fastest Growing

North America dominates the global market with a 33.96% share in 2025, supported by strong consumer spending on reproductive health, widespread availability of OTC fertility supplements, and well-established fertility clinic networks. The region benefits from advanced regulatory frameworks and high awareness of preconception health.

Europe holds a 26.93% market share, driven by preventive healthcare initiatives, increased female workforce participation, and growing demand for clean-label, organic supplements. European consumers show strong preference for natural formulations, aligning with sustainability and wellness trends.

Asia Pacific is the fastest-growing region, registering a CAGR of 5.15% between 2026 and 2032. Rising infertility cases in China, expanding nutraceutical markets in India, and the rapid growth of e-commerce platforms in Japan and Southeast Asia are fueling regional expansion. Online distribution channels are playing a pivotal role in improving accessibility and product penetration.

Emerging markets in the Middle East, Africa, and South America are also witnessing increasing adoption, though affordability and regulatory constraints remain key challenges.

Risk Analysis: Regulatory and Pricing Pressures to Shape Market Evolution

The Fertility Supplements Market faces varying levels of risk across regions:

  • Regulatory & Claim Approval Risk remains medium to high, particularly in Europe, where stringent claim substantiation requirements apply.

  • Product Efficacy & Trust Risk is relatively low in North America but moderate elsewhere due to varying quality standards and consumer skepticism.

  • Pricing & Affordability Risk is high in emerging economies, limiting adoption of premium products.

  • Import-Export Dependency poses challenges in regions heavily reliant on ingredient imports.

  • Competition & Brand Saturation is intensifying, especially in Asia Pacific and North America.

Despite these risks, long-term market stability is supported by rising infertility prevalence, increasing ART adoption, and greater integration of supplements into fertility treatment protocols.
